6. minals that require clamping in the binding posts be sure to arrange the leads so that they do not short circuit the amplifier Clamp the connections tightly but do not over tighten them do not for instance tighten the binding posts with pliers Check this sort of connection periodically to make sure that the wire is still tightly gripped Better still use high quality cables factory fitted with appropriate plugs Tornado mono amplifiers are suitable for use with most current loudspeaker systems with an impedance rating between 2 and 16 Ohms Contact your dealer if you have a particularly unusual loudspeaker system and are uncertain about how your amplifier might react to it Under all normal circumstances the amplifier is well protected against encounters with demanding speakers it has thermal protection voltage and current limiting and DC offset protection MUTE LINK INPUT This is to allow simultaneous mute control over the power amplifier when used with a Hurricane pre amplifier just connect using the 3 5mm jack lead provided with your Hurricane pre amplifier BI WIRING Although two sets of speaker terminales are provided if you intend to bi wire or tri wire your loudspeakers we recommend that you use cables fitted with a single pair of plugs at the amplifier end for four reasons 1 To bi tri wire properly you should have a common ground point 2 Trying to squeeze two or three individual cables into a binding pos
7. plifier will drive longer speaker cables you will find its performance improves with shorter cables The use of litz or goertz type cables may cause your amplifier to overheat under certain circumstances These are best avoided REAR PANEL A diagram can be found on page 6 of this manual MAINS CONNECTIONS The Tornado s mains switch is fitted in the centre of the rear panel Use this to switch off the amplifier completely Below it is an IEC socket into which the supplied mains lead fits If an internal fuse should blow i e the blue LED will not illuminate when the amplifier is not hot but plugged in and switched on then the amplifier should be returned to your dealer for examination Any replacement should only be of an identical type The amplifier whilst powered ON will be warm to the touch even as idle due to the class A quiescent current flowing in the output stage This is perfectly normal INPUT CONNECTIONS The input sockets for the Tornado are either RCA phono or XLR balanced Connect your pre amplifiers main audio outputs to these Us the rear mounted switch to select the input type that you have connected to The switch points towards the input selected SPEAKER CONNECTIONS Gold plated 5 way binding posts are provided for your speakers connections as well as BFA safety type terminals The red terminal is the positive connection and the black terminal is negative If you use bare cables or spade ter

10. the best performance we suggest you place it on a specialist hi fi support There are many suitable designs available which your dealer will be happy to advise you about Position the amplifier so that it will not be subjected to high ambient temperatures avoid sites where it will be in direct sunlight or close to a central heating radiator For your own safety and your amplifier s well being do not allow it to come into contact with water it away from potted plants to avoid those all too common watering accidents To clean the amplifiers case disconnect it from the wall Socket and wipe it with a barely damp lint free cloth or chamois leather If you suspect that water has entered the casework return the amplifier to your dealer so that he can examine it Once you have installed the amplifier please do not throw away its packaging If you move home or need to return the unit to your dealer for example for upgrade the original packaging will protect it and ensure it arrives undamaged ELECTRICAL CONNECTIONS The Tornado comes with a ready assembled mains lead and we suggest that you use this to connect it to the mains supply We strongly recommend that you connect the lead directly to a wall socket and do not use extension blocks which degrade sound quality For the same reason we also advise against line filters and mains conditioners If your mains supply is noisy or you have household appliances that gener
